Transaction 1faf5cd2554623d7a960c87728ffd2ed255f3515e861dc23291e91f0f64fbf94
1 Input
1 Output
-
1faf5cd2554623d7a960c87728ffd2ed255f3515e861dc23291e91f0f64fbf94:0
- value
- 149970000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 462d7ccbf011694a3d174e882926e1260ac0cb4d O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Q4nxLfr2wBRSMNtDmvLJ6FgQiWr5JMLK